Use a Pneumatic Forklift
Pneumatic forklifts are common in shipping and warehouse operations. Also called pallet trucks or pump trucks, they are used to transport supplies and things around on wooden pallets utilizing metal forks which are mounted on a wheeled counterweight. The counterweight contains a pump which raises the forks off the ground. A pallet truck is intended to be operated by a single person.

To avoid loosing control while lifting heavy loads, pallet trucks should always be operated with care. Machine should be checked prior to operating. Clear the wheels area of any obstructions. Make sure that the handle smoothly turns. The pallet should be stacked carefully to be able to guarantee that nothing would fall off during transportation.

On the end of the pallet truck's handle, squeeze the level found on the inside of the metal loop in order to lower the forks and release the air in the pump. The forks could then be pushed into the slots of the pallet. The forks should be centered to ensure equal distribution of the pallet's weight across them. Lift the forks from the ground by pumping the handle of the pneumatic lift until the pallet has cleared the ground completely. Do not lift the pallet very high or the forklift could unbalance.

Move the pallet by pulling on the handle and then dragging it behind you. It is really not safe to push the pallet ahead of you as the thrust could cause it to go out of control. Take turns slowly and don't attempt to stop suddenly. Slowly come to a stop, squeeze the lever, and the forks will lower to the ground. Lastly, remove the forks from the pallet by pulling them out. Return the pallet truck to its permanent location.
